Plastic Waste Baler

A plastic waste baler is a machine designed to compress and bundle plastic waste materials into compact and manageable bales for easier handling, transportation, and recycling. The process involves feeding plastic waste into the baler, where it is compressed using hydraulic pressure into dense blocks or bales. These bales are then securely strapped or wrapped to maintain their shape and integrity during handling and transportation.

Plastic waste balers are commonly used in various industries and facilities that generate large volumes of plastic waste, such as manufacturing plants, recycling centers, retail stores, warehouses, and distribution centers. They are particularly beneficial for managing plastic packaging waste, plastic bottles, containers, and other types of plastic materials.

Key features of plastic waste balers may include:

  1. Hydraulic Systems: These balers typically utilize hydraulic systems to apply pressure for compressing the plastic waste. Hydraulic cylinders exert force to compact the materials efficiently.
  2. Bale Size and Density Control: Balers often offer adjustable settings for controlling the size and density of the bales produced, allowing operators to tailor the output according to specific requirements and storage limitations.
  3. Safety Features: Modern balers are equipped with safety mechanisms to ensure operator protection during the baling process. These features may include emergency stop buttons, safety interlocks, and protective guarding.
  4. Easy Operation: Many plastic waste balers are designed for user-friendly operation, featuring intuitive controls and automated functions for efficient processing of plastic waste.
  5. Durability and Reliability: Given the demanding nature of waste management operations, balers are built to withstand heavy-duty use and are constructed from durable materials to ensure long-term reliability.
  6. Integration with Conveyor Systems: Some balers can be integrated with conveyor systems for seamless feeding of plastic waste into the baling chamber, streamlining the overall waste handling process.
  7. Environmental Benefits: By compacting plastic waste into dense bales, balers facilitate more efficient transportation and storage, reducing the carbon footprint associated with waste disposal and promoting recycling initiatives.

Overall, plastic waste balers play a crucial role in waste management strategies by facilitating the consolidation and recycling of plastic materials, thereby contributing to environmental sustainability and resource conservation efforts.
